Description
Image depicts 2 women who dance facing each other, arms raised, playing finger cymbals. They wear wide pantaloons belted with striped fabric and low cut tops with long, hanging sleeves; their hair falls in long braids from under small turbans. Seated on the floor are 3 accompanists: 2 play stringed instruments with bows; the other strikes a tambourine.
